Just reading this response, its clear you dont know much about what is really going on with regards to Spydertrader and the journal. You say "having people desperately go into SCT" just shows ignorance of the entire situation. SCT is not the method being taught in the journal, SCT is a natural consequence of probably years of applying the same approaches day in and day out; lots of repetition and screen-time experience. The method that Spydertrader is laying out in his thread is a structured way of seeing the market in order to profit from it consistently. Its not about being an "SCT trader" its about breaking down the market into contexts. Knowing those contexts leads you to know what to do in any given situation. Anyone who thinks that reading the thread and working through the drills for a few months will lead them to trading "SCT" is an idiot and a dreamer. But those who see how breaking the market down into meaningful contexts leads to finding profitable trading opportunities, well, thats another story altogether. That being said, I do not trade SCT but I do use core fundamental aspects of what I've learned in that thread to help me pick my spots. I also use my own experience from trading equities as well as the things I have learned while watching/trading the ES day in and day out (price action). In the end, you cant follow anyone blindly into anything when it comes to trading but you certainly cant say that the info in the journal isnt very valuable and helpful because it certainly is.
